    What Is a Sparkle (Starlight) Effect?

    A sparkle effect takes the brightest points in your image and turns them into stars with radiating rays. Photographers have done this optically for decades using a star filter, a piece of glass etched with a fine grid that splits point light sources into streaks. The digital version works the same way, except you get to decide after the shoot how strong the effect should be.

    Behind the scenes, a good starlight effect:

    • Detects highlights above a brightness threshold, so only real light sources react instead of every pale pixel.
    • Draws symmetrical rays outward from each of those points, typically four, six or eight per star.
    • Adds a soft bloom around the core so the star has a glowing centre rather than hard lines.
    • Optionally tints the rays and introduces a slight chromatic spread, which is what makes the sparkle read as light rather than as a drawn-on graphic.

    The difference between a magical photo and a tacky one comes down to restraint. Real star filters only ever affect a few highlights, because a scene rarely contains dozens of intense point sources. Keeping that same logic in editing is the single most useful rule in this guide.

    When to Use a Sparkle Effect

    Sparkle needs something to sparkle on. Before you open any editor, ask whether the photo actually contains small, bright, well-separated highlights. If it does, the effect will feel natural. If it does not, no amount of slider tuning will save it.

    • Fairy lights and candles – The classic use case. String lights, tealights and lanterns are small, bright and evenly spaced, which is exactly what star flares need.
    • Weddings and engagements – Rings, sequins, champagne glasses, sparklers and reception lighting all respond beautifully, and the effect matches the romantic tone of the images.
    • Night cityscapes – Street lamps, headlights and lit windows turn a flat night skyline into something that looks like a film still.
    • Backlit portraits – Sun through leaves, hair rim light and background bokeh give you a handful of highlights to accent without touching the face.
    • Water and snow – Sunlight on ripples, wet pavement after rain and fresh snow all produce specular glints that become convincing sparkles.
    • Product and jewellery shots – A single well-placed star on a stone or a polished edge reads as quality rather than as a filter.

    Photos that generally do not benefit: flat overcast scenes, evenly lit interiors, documents and screenshots, and any image where the brightest area is a large surface rather than a point.     Step 3 – Set the intensity

    Intensity controls how bright and prominent each star is. A 40–80% range covers most photos. Below 40% the effect is barely visible on screen and disappears entirely once Instagram compresses the image; above 80% the rays start to overwhelm the underlying scene.

    A reliable method is to push intensity higher than you want, find the point where it clearly looks like too much, then pull back roughly a third. That final position is almost always the one you would have chosen anyway, and you get there faster than by creeping up from zero.

    Step 4 – Tune the threshold so only real highlights react

    The threshold decides how bright a pixel must be before it becomes a star. This is the control that separates a believable result from a glitter explosion.

    • Too low – Skin highlights, pale fabric and bright sky pick up sparkles they should not have.
    • Too high – Only one or two lights react and the effect looks accidental.
    • Right – The lights you would point at if someone asked which parts of the scene are bright are exactly the ones that sparkle.

    Raise the threshold until the sparkles on unimportant areas vanish, then stop. Everything else can be fixed with intensity.

    Step 5 – Choose ray count, size and angle

    These three settings define the personality of the sparkle.

    • Ray count – Four rays give a clean, classic cross that suits weddings and portraits. Six feels more ornamental and works for festive scenes. Eight or more quickly reads as a graphic overlay, so use it deliberately.
    • Size – Rays should stay comfortably shorter than the distance between neighbouring lights. Once stars from adjacent highlights overlap, the image turns into a web of lines.
    • Angle – A slight rotation away from perfectly horizontal and vertical looks more organic, since a physical filter is rarely aligned to the frame exactly.

    Step 6 – Match the sparkle colour to the scene

    Pure white rays over warm tungsten lighting look pasted on. Tint the sparkle toward the colour of the light source it is coming from: warm amber for candles, string lights and golden hour; cool blue or silver for moonlight, snow and night city scenes; a hint of the dominant colour for neon.

    Keep the tint subtle. You are nudging the rays toward the scene's palette, not colouring them in.

    Step 7 – Layer with a soft glow, then export

    Sparkle on its own can feel sharp against a clean digital image. Adding a small amount of soft glow underneath blends the star cores into the surrounding light and gives the whole frame a cohesive dreamy finish.

    Recommended Sparkle Settings by Photo Type

    Treat these as starting points rather than presets. The right numbers depend on how many highlights your frame contains and how large they are.

    Wedding and couple photography

    • Intensity around 50–65%, four rays, moderate size.
    • High threshold so only candles, string lights and rings react, never skin or the dress.
    • Warm tint to match reception lighting.

    The goal is a few deliberate accents that support the moment. Faces should stay the brightest thing the eye lands on.

    Night city and street scenes

    • Intensity 60–80%, six rays for a slightly more dramatic look.
    • Smaller ray size, because dense city lights sit close together and long rays merge into clutter.
    • Cool or neutral tint, unless neon dominates.

    This is where sparkle does the most work, turning an ordinary skyline into a cinematic frame.

    Backlit and golden hour portraits

    • Intensity 40–55%, four rays, generous size.
    • Very high threshold so only the sun and the strongest bokeh highlights sparkle.
    • Warm golden tint, paired with a light soft glow.

    One large star on the sun behind your subject usually beats a dozen small ones scattered through the background.

    Christmas, parties and festive scenes

    • Intensity 55–70%, six rays, medium size.
    • Moderate threshold, since tree lights are the subject and are supposed to sparkle.
    • Warm tint, with a slight angle offset for variety.

    Festive images tolerate more sparkle than any other category, but a decorated tree can still contain a hundred bulbs, so watch for overlapping rays.

    Product and jewellery

    • Intensity 45–60%, four rays, small size.
    • Highest threshold available so a single specular glint reacts.
    • Neutral or slightly cool tint for metals and stones.

    Restraint matters most here. One precise star communicates shine; several communicate a filter.

    Common Sparkle Mistakes (and How to Fix Them)

    Almost every bad sparkle photo fails for one of these five reasons.

    • Sparkles everywhere – The threshold is too low, so mid-tones are being treated as light sources. Raise it until only genuine highlights react, then re-check intensity.
    • Rays overlapping into a mesh – Ray size is too large for how densely packed the lights are. Shorten the rays rather than reducing intensity; you keep the brightness and lose the clutter.
    • Sparkle on faces and skin – Bright foreheads and catchlights are easy targets for a low threshold. Nothing ruins a portrait faster. Raise the threshold and, if the tool allows it, keep the effect away from the subject entirely.
    • Stars that look pasted on – Usually a colour mismatch or a missing bloom. Tint the rays toward the light source and add a touch of soft glow so the star core melts into the highlight instead of sitting on top of it.
    • Sparkle disappearing after upload – Social platforms recompress images and thin rays are the first casualty. Export at maximum quality, and if the effect vanishes on Instagram, add roughly 10% more intensity than looked right on your desktop.

    One more habit worth adopting: step away from the image for a minute and come back to it. Sparkle is a strong effect and your eye adapts to it quickly, which is why edits that felt balanced during the session often look overdone the next morning.
